Hi, and welcome to the rotation. The Driftwren parcel-tracking webhook is the piece most plugin authors ask about. It delivers scan events at-least-once, so duplicate deliveries are expected and your handlers must be idempotent. If deliveries stall, check the dead-letter queue before assuming an outage; most stalls are malformed signatures from a single partner. Escalate only if the queue grows past 10k. The delivery dashboard and signature-validation guide live on the internal page below.

runbook for kahap-yageg: https://sentry.merlaqgrid.corp/issue/deploy/dash/job/56a2db96e11ebc18

Onboarding — Pavilion Kiosk watchdog. Each kiosk runs a watchdog process that restarts the display app if it hangs for more than 20 seconds. You'll see watchdog events in the kiosk health panel as amber entries; three restarts in an hour escalates to a hard reboot. Support can silence a noisy watchdog remotely, but only after authenticating to the kiosk recovery console. The console won't accept your normal login — it asks for the shared recovery passphrase, which is listed directly below.

strongbox words: sorir-belvan-rusix-ulays-ralmir-praix-eliir-tamax-praael-druael-julir-tamius-jorir

## Sensor drift: what to do at 3am

If the GrowLoop controller starts reporting humidity swings that don't match the backup probes in the Fernwick greenhouse, it's almost always sensor drift, not an actual climate event. Don't panic and don't touch the vents manually. First, restart the calibration daemon and give it ten minutes to re-baseline. If readings still disagree by more than 5%, flip the controller into safe mode. The safe-mode thresholds it will use are these.

config for yahap-bajof:
[istix]
host = istix.qorvelsys.internal
user = istix_svc
database = istix_prod